Q: Is 50,511,611 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 50,511,611 is a composite number.

Why is 50,511,611 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 50,511,611 can be evenly divided by 1 23 59 1,357 37,223 856,129 2,196,157 and 50,511,611, with no remainder.

Since 50,511,611 cannot be divided by just 1 and 50,511,611, it is a composite number.
